Course Enrollment

Visiting exchange students do not have to enroll in the courses that they take. Simply visit the courses that interest you. However, every course might set its own, individual rules for the exam permission: Students may need to give a presentation, solve a project, or pass all exercises. These requirements are usually explained by the teachers at the beginning of their courses! For this reason, we recommend asking in class what the prerequisites are and how to register for these prerequisites. Any prerequisites for the courses (required classes, knowledge, certificates etc.) are usually provided in the course descriptions. So interested students should pay attention to these prerequisites and, in case certain details are not clear, ask the teachers. Also note that most courses have a webpage in the Ilias system, where the lecturers provide their material. Join these courses in Ilias to access the material or ask in class, how materials are being shared.
